
Timberwolves vs. Kings Prediction, Odds, Picks - Nov. 9
The Minnesota Timberwolves (5-4) square off against the Sacramento Kings (3-6) on November 9, 2025 on FDSN and NBCS-CA. Sunday's matchup between the Timberwolves and the Kings features the Timberwolves as 4.5-point favorites. The point total for the game is set at 238.5.

Timberwolves Leaders
- Julius Randle posts 25.9 points, 7.2 boards and 6.3 assists per game, shooting 55.5% from the field and 42.6% from beyond the arc with 2.2 made treys per game.
- Jaden McDaniels posts 18.3 points, 4.4 rebounds and 2 assists per game. At the other end, he averages 0.9 steals and 1.4 blocks.
- Donte DiVincenzo puts up 14.4 points, 3.8 rebounds and 3.8 assists per contest. Defensively, he averages 1.1 steals and 0.4 blocks.
- Rudy Gobert posts 9.7 points, 9.7 boards and 1.6 assists per contest, shooting 73.5% from the floor (second in NBA).
- Naz Reid averages 11 points, 1.7 assists and 5.1 boards.

Kings Leaders
- On a per-game basis, Russell Westbrook gives the Kings 16 points, 7.1 rebounds and 6 assists. He also averages 1.2 steals and 0.1 blocked shots.
- DeMar DeRozan is putting up 20.7 points, 3.9 rebounds and 3.8 assists per game. He's making 48.9% of his shots from the field.
- The Kings are getting 13.8 points, 3.7 rebounds and 7 assists per game from Dennis Schroder this season.
- Zach LaVine is putting up 25.1 points, 3.3 rebounds and 2 assists per game. He is making 51.9% of his shots from the floor and 39.7% from beyond the arc, with 3.1 treys per game (10th in league).
- Domantas Sabonis is putting up 14.5 points, 14.2 rebounds and 4 assists per game. He is draining 52.2% of his shots from the floor.
